Transaction 7989988c3199f2a3719e79845bb0a9eb52e4380f14bf935bccf38393a999c6d6

block
a7144c5f81df0fdce2764c785e2d0b925adf12833310a7f3168661005c3f79d7

1 Input

23 Outputs